With this issue we celebrate the 90th anniversary of the founding of Harvard Business Review. In case you're wondering, there is no traditional gift for a 90th—perhaps because things rarely last that long. But HBR, we're proud to say, has managed to endure—and to thrive. We've gone through several face-lifts since 1922, but we've remained true to the vision of our founders: that "business theory" based on rigorous research can help managers run their companies more effectively.
